Ubuntu选哪个版本?
结论先行:
When choosing an Ubuntu version, the Long-Term Support (LTS) releases are typically the best choice for most users due to their stability and extended support periods. As of my latest update, the recommended version is Ubuntu 20.04 LTS ("Focal Fossa"), which offers a balance between modern features and long-term support until April 2025. For those who prefer more frequent updates with the latest software, Ubuntu 22.04 LTS ("Jammy Jellyfish") is also an excellent choice, providing support until April 2027.
Introduction:
Ubuntu, one of the most popular Linux distributions, caters to a wide range of users, from beginners to advanced developers. Its versatility is partly due to the variety of versions available, each tailored to specific needs. This article explores the different Ubuntu versions, focusing on the key considerations for selecting the most suitable one based on your requirements.
Understanding Ubuntu Versions:
Ubuntu releases new versions every six months, with major releases in April and October. However, not all versions are created equal. Some are designated as Long-Term Support (LTS) releases, while others are standard releases. Here’s a breakdown:
- Standard Releases: These are released every six months and receive nine months of support.
- LTS Releases: These are released every two years and receive five years of support, making them ideal for production environments and users who prioritize stability over cutting-edge features.
Key Considerations:
1. Stability vs. Cutting-Edge Features
Stability: If you require a rock-solid system that doesn’t change much over time, an LTS release is the way to go. These versions undergo extensive testing and are less likely to have bugs or compatibility issues.
Cutting-Edge Features: For those who want access to the latest software and tools, standard releases offer more frequent updates. However, these versions may be less stable than LTS releases, especially shortly after release.
2. Support Periods
Long-Term Support: LTS releases are supported for five years, making them ideal for organizations and individuals who need to maintain a consistent environment without frequent upgrades.
Shorter Support: Standard releases are supported for nine months, which might be sufficient for users who don’t mind frequent upgrades or are comfortable managing their own support.
3. Community and Ecosystem
Community: The Ubuntu community is vast and active, with numerous forums, documentation, and resources available. LTS releases tend to have a larger community base due to their stability and longevity.
Ecosystem: The ecosystem around Ubuntu is rich and diverse, with a wide range of applications, drivers, and tools. LTS releases often have better compatibility with third-party software and hardware.
4. Security Updates
Regular Updates: Both LTS and standard releases receive regular security updates. However, LTS releases provide longer-term security support, which is crucial for critical systems.
Emergency Patches: In cases where urgent security patches are needed, LTS releases are more likely to receive immediate attention from the development team.
5. Customization and Personalization
Desktop Environment: Ubuntu comes with several desktop environments, including GNOME, KDE Plasma, Xfce, and MATE. LTS releases typically stick with a more mature and tested desktop environment, while standard releases might include newer versions with experimental features.
Themes and Customizations: The availability of themes and customizations varies across versions. LTS releases might have fewer cutting-edge options but are generally more stable.
6. Resource Consumption
System Requirements: LTS releases are designed to be efficient and work well on older hardware. They are optimized for performance and resource consumption, making them suitable for both low-end and high-end systems.
Memory and CPU Usage: Standard releases might consume more resources due to the inclusion of newer software and features. This can be a consideration for users with limited hardware resources.
7. Compatibility and Integration
Software Compatibility: LTS releases ensure backward compatibility with existing software, making them ideal for enterprise environments where software integration is crucial.
Hardware Compatibility: Standard releases might offer better compatibility with newer hardware, although LTS releases are usually quite capable in this area as well.
Conclusion:
Choosing the right Ubuntu version ultimately depends on your specific needs and preferences. If stability and long-term support are paramount, an LTS release like Ubuntu 20.04 LTS or Ubuntu 22.04 LTS is the best choice. For those who value the latest features and don’t mind more frequent updates, standard releases are a good fit. Regardless of your choice, Ubuntu offers a robust platform that supports a wide range of use cases, making it a top choice for many Linux enthusiasts and professionals alike.
This article aims to provide a comprehensive guide to help you make an informed decision when choosing an Ubuntu version. Whether you’re a beginner or an experienced user, understanding the differences between LTS and standard releases can significantly impact your experience with Ubuntu.
CLOUD知识